How to play
Rules
There are not many hard rules, but generally
- You play for one year in-game time. Turns should begin and end on 1st Granite.
- Avoid using blatant exploits (the game is built of cheese, so this is sort of like the pornography rule, "you know it when you see it.") Things like perpetual motion machines or material duplication schemes should be shunned. Some things classified as exploits, like "atom smashers" should be fine as long as their applications aren't egregious.
- Try not to save-scum (Do save though. Crashes happen, and named "save and continue" saves won't clutter the main save).
- You are free to use DFHack, but do not use any of it's "Armok" (god-mode) features. Also, try to keep it modest. The fort shouldn't fail catastrophically if the next player doesn't have DFHack installed.
